The 3GPP video codec is
a highly optimized video encoding and decoding library intended
for low power consumption applications. Reduced memory and MIPS
allow the utilization of the library in portable devices (mobile
phones, PDA's, others)
Optimized algorithms and code enable real-time encoding and
decoding at QCIF resolution. This permits the deployment of the
library in a variety of interactive and streaming applications.
This library meets requirements defined in 3GPP specifications and
enables MPEG-4 or H.263 codestream creation and decoding.
Proprietary efficient Motion Estimation and zero DCT coefficients
prediction algorithms are implemented in the Codec. These
algorithms significantly reduce computational complexity and
power consumption of the encoder.

Features: |
- MPEG-4 Visual Simple
Profile
- H.263 Baseline (profile 0) codec
- H.263 Interactive and Streaming Wireless Profile (profile 3)
codec
- H.263 Deblocking Filter as MPEG-4 postfilter
- Available as MPEG-4 library, H.263 library or MPEG-4/H.263
library
|
Technical
Specs: |
- 15 fps QCIF encoding
at 44 MHz on ARM 9
- 15 fps QCIF decoding at 12 MHz on ARM 9
- Encoder memory bandwidth less than 250 MB/sec
- Decoder memory bandwidth less than 75 MB/sec
